Water Drains always from coolant reservoir while the car is stationary. I refill water every day in the coolant reservoir.

The car temperature is fine, it does not overheat. While driving the water level is always fine.

You only notice this drain the following day during routine check.

Start with a cooling system pressure test, this will help locate any external coolant leaks.
